Attic Moisture Can Lead to Major Damage

As summer humidity begins to ramp up, it’s important to pay special attention to one of the most neglected areas of the home. Your attic can hold a lot of moisture and if it’s not insulated and ventilated correctly, that means major issues for you, the homeowner. In this two-part series, we’ll discuss how moisture can accumulate in the attic and what you can do to protect your home from serious damage. Let’s kick things off with a list of the major moisture-conducting culprits:

  1. Insufficient ventilation: Without proper airflow, moisture from the living spaces below can become trapped in the attic, leading to condensation and elevated humidity levels.

  2. Roof leaks: Damaged or deteriorating roofing materials can allow water to enter the attic during rain storms or snowmelt. Roof leaks can be caused by missing or cracked shingles, damaged flashing, or compromised roof seals.

  3. Plumbing leaks: Plumbing pipes that run through the attic can develop leaks over time. Even a small drip or a slow leak can contribute to moisture accumulation in the attic.

  4. Inadequate insulation: As hot and cold air collide, they will condensate or freeze. Without proper insulation and temperature regulation, it’s much easier for moisture to accumulate.

  5. Blocked vents: Blocked or obstructed attic vents can impede proper airflow, preventing moisture from escaping. This can result in increased humidity levels and potential condensation problems.

  6. Misdirected exhaust fans: If bathroom or kitchen exhaust fans are not vented directly outside, they can introduce warm, moist air into the attic space. This can cause condensation and moisture-related issues.

  7. Poorly sealed attic access points: Gaps or insufficient sealing around attic access points, such as doors or hatches, can allow humid air from the lower floors to enter the attic, leading to moisture buildup.

  8. Insufficient vapor barrier: A vapor barrier is a layer designed to prevent moisture from passing through walls and ceilings. If there is an inadequate or damaged vapor barrier in the attic, it can allow moisture to penetrate and cause problems.

It's important to address any water issues in the attic promptly to decrease the chances of mold growth, wood rot, or structural damage. Because most people access their attic infrequently, problems often don’t go detected until water starts showing up on the ceiling. What To Do About Warped Siding

A question I get from readers time and time again is about vinyl siding that looks “wrinkled” even when it’s new. Many people think warped siding is an environmental problem and that too much sun and heat or even the contrasting winter cold is what’s creating the damage. Little do they know that warping has very little to do with the weather and a whole lot to do with how it’s put on the home.

Let’s start with the real name of the problem. Siding that is wrinkling or warping is actually called “oil canning” or “stress buckling” and it happens when the siding isn’t installed properly.

All homes are made of natural materials such as wood, which expand and contract with seasonal changes. People love vinyl siding because it’s very low maintenance and offers fantastic curb appeal, but a DIY or inexperienced install can actually make a house look much worse, even with very new siding. 

Every house needs to expand and contract. While it might seem logical to nail vinyl siding tightly to make sure it doesn’t come loose, doing so will actually cause the panel to buckle because it can’t “breathe” with the house. That’s why most vinyl siding panels come with longer nail slots instead of small holes. It gives everything room to move and shift. 

Another possible siding installation pitfall is leaving too much overlap between panels. While you might think this creates a stronger bond, it actually restricts movement, causing the siding to stretch and then buckle in the same way.

Back to my reader’s question. Is there ever a time when the sun might cause siding to warp? The answer is not really, although I have seen damage from sunlight reflecting off an adjacent window. The only other thing that could cause an issue is your gas grill, so keep it far away from the house. 

Once oil canning happens, the siding has to be replaced. Because the issue is installation, the product’s warranty is worthless and the manufacturer isn’t going to be responsible for the defect. While removing panels is pretty straightforward, it can be tough to get a color match if the siding is a bit older. 

These are all the reasons why it’s so important to work with a contractor who knows what he or she is doing. If you’re going to tackle this job on your own, make sure you do your research and know all the common mistakes that can be made. You don’t want all that hard work to result in a home aesthetic that’s anything less than perfect.

Summer Humidity Can Cause Problems in the Home

It won’t be long before summer weather is in full swing.

With New England's heat also comes humidity, a potential problem that every homeowner needs to keep in check. While we can’t control the weather outside, moisture in the house can be a major problem, contributing to mold, mildew, and overall dampness, especially in the attic and basement. 

 Many homeowners combat humidity by using air conditioners in their houses, and while they can reduce the moisture in the air to some degree, this is by no means their primary function. An air conditioner works by sucking the air from your home, cooling it, and blowing it back into the house. That process does reduce the humidity slightly, but pairing your air conditioner with a dehumidifier is a much smarter option.

 A dehumidifier works by pulling the moisture out of the air and storing the excess water in a holding tank. Many people keep dehumidifiers in their basements all year long to control the dampness that can often be felt in these underground areas. This is a great idea because controlling the humidity in the part of your home that holds the most water will very likely help to regulate the rest of the house.  

One way to know if your house is holding a lot of moisture is to purchase a simple five-dollar humidity gauge from the local hardware store. Ideally, you want the humidity to be under 50 percent. If it’s higher, you might want to consider using a dehumidifier in the main part of your home, especially on hot summer days and in areas where you spend the most time. 

In addition to cooling the air and decreasing moisture, running a dehumidifier during the hottest parts of the hottest days can also prevent mold and mildew growth, eliminate musty odors in the home, and prevent old pipes from sweating. Plus, you can use the water collected in the tank to give your plants a good drink. 

If you’re thinking that a dehumidifier might be a good solution for you, they come in different sizes and can be used for residential or commercial purposes. Generally, a unit will come in 25, 30, and 40-pint models, and on average a 25-pint unit will be sufficient to operate in a 1,000-square-foot area.

Dehumidifiers generally run on about half the energy of an air conditioning unit, so as long as you don’t run them all day, using one shouldn’t affect your energy bill. Just be sure to keep windows and doors closed when you run your unit, and only switch the power on during the most humid time of the day, or when the air is above 50 percent humidity. Also, be aware that dehumidifiers by nature are drying, so try not to run them while you’re occupying the room over a long period of time, like when you’re sleeping at night.

Finally, if you have a dehumidifier, be sure to keep the filter clean. Dust, dirt, and debris can build up, preventing air from flowing freely and potentially circulating mold spores throughout the home. A simple wipe-down with a damp cloth and spray bottle filled with a cleaning solution will do the trick to keep you breathing freely and ensure a longer life for your appliance.
